Weather in September

The first month of the autumn, September, is also a moderately hot month in Jiabong, Philippines, with temperature in the range of an average low of 23.4°C (74.1°F) and an average high of 29.8°C (85.6°F).

Temperature

As August transitions into September, the average high-temperature rests at a moderately hot 29.8°C (85.6°F), maintaining a close resemblance to the previous month. Jiabong experiences a mean temperature of 23.4°C (74.1°F) during September nights.

Heat index

During September, the heat index is evaluated at a sweltering 38°C (100.4°F). Incorporate special precautions, risk of heat exhaustion and heat cramps is substantial. Sustained activity could cause heatstroke.
Be informed that the heat index values are oriented around shady conditions and gentle breezes. The heat index might be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sun ex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', reflects the blend of air temperature and relative humidity to give a temperature impression. A person's impression of weather can be affected by numerous aspects, among them metabolic variations, pregnancy, and activity levels. Keep in mind that direct sunshine exposure can amplify the weather's effects, possibly increasing the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ly important for children. In general, children are more at risk than adults because they sweat less. Furthermore, the large skin surface compared to their small bodies and the high heat production due to their actions contribute to this vulnerability.
The human body normally cools itself by perspiration. Excessive warmth is eliminated from the body by evaporation of sweat. With higher relative humidity, the rate of evaporation is reduced, resulting in increased heat retention in the body compared to drier air. Heat-related complications, like dehydration, can manifest if the body's heat gain exceeds its dissipation capacity.

Humidity

In September, the average relative humidity in Jiabong is 85%.

Rainfall

In Jiabong, in September, it is raining for 25 days, with typically 95mm (3.74")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, in Jiabong, there are 250 rainfall days, and 834mm (32.83") of precipitation is accumulated.

Sea temperature

In September, the average sea temperature in Jiabong is 29.1°C (84.4°F).
Note: Water temperatures in the range of 25°C (77°F) to 29°C (84.2°F) are warm and delightful, ensuring comfort during water activities over extended periods.

Daylight

In September, the average length of the day is 12h and 12min.
On the first day of September, sunrise is at 5:29 am and sunset at 5:50 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:29 am and sunset at 5:31 pm PST.

Sunshine

In September, the average sunshine is 7.9h.

UV index

February through September and November,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The UV index of 7 during September translates into the following guidance:
Undertake precautions and comply with sun safety standards. Protection from skin and eye injury is vital. Avoid direct S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., a period when UV radiation is most intense, and remember that not all shade structures provide full protection. A wide-brimmed hat is a shield, deflecting up to 50% of harmful UV radiation from eyes. Take warning! Reflective sand and water surfaces intensify the Sun's UV rays.
